【问题标题】:Versioning docx file in SubversionSubversion 中的版本控制 docx 文件
【发布时间】:2011-08-19 12:02:06
【问题描述】:

我想知道是否有一种方法可以在 subversion 中以我可以比较和指责的方式对 Word 2007/2010 文件进行版本控制?

我发现该文件可以保存为 XML,然后作为普通 docx 文件打开。但是它不是美化的XML文件,这使得浏览diff和blank有点困难。

问题:在 SVN 中对 MS Word 文档进行版本控制的最佳方法是什么?

【问题讨论】:

  • 我不确定如何在 SVN 中处理这个问题,但你看过 Sharepoint 吗?
  • 我还知道将 Word 文档存储在各种源代码控制系统中,但它们确实不是完成这项工作的最佳工具。 XML 可能是半可读的,但它主要是供计算机读取的。 Sharepoint 是一个很好的解决方案。如果 Sharepoint 不是一个选项,那么按照 Oded 的建议打开 Track Changes 也很好。
  • 法律黑线、比较和跟踪更改都是比较 Word 文档的内置方法。为什么选择SVN? - 这似乎有点矫枉过正
  • @Duffman - 如果他们还没有使用 Sharepoint,那么购买它会非常昂贵。即使有了它,难道你不能只看到以前的版本而没有 OP 正在寻找的差异功能吗?
  • 亲爱的上帝,有人建议 Sharepoint...

标签: xml svn version-control ms-word docx


【解决方案1】:

使用内置的revisions tool,又名“跟踪更改”有什么问题?

它是单词的一部分,您只需将不同的版本存储在源代码管理中,修订跟踪应该给您“责备”。

【讨论】:

  • 链接已失效,能否更新一下,谢谢。
【解决方案2】:

这个问题的答案其实在这里:http://svn.haxx.se/users/archive-2007-03/1473.shtml

将 svn:mime 类型的 application/msword 应用于所有 Word 文件 额外的预防措施。如果你使用 TortoiseSVN,它带有一个脚本 这将让您使用查看 2 个版本之间的差异 Word 的内置功能。

而且,与其他问题非常相似:Is version control (ie. Subversion) applicable in document tracking?

【讨论】:

    猜你喜欢
    • 2011-04-15
    • 1970-01-01
    • 1970-01-01
    • 2011-03-18
    • 2011-09-10
    • 1970-01-01
    • 2014-04-07
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多